OSQA

OSQA is a robust, open-source question and answer system designed to power community-driven knowledge sharing platforms. Built on Python and Django, it provides the tools needed to create Stack Overflow-style forums where users can ask, answer, and rate questions.

OSQA

OSQA

Analysis & Comparison

Advantages

Free to use and modify due to its open-source license.
Built on the robust and flexible Python/Django framework.
Effective community-driven content creation and moderation.
Creates a searchable knowledge base from user interactions.
Customizable to specific needs for developers.

Limitations

Requires technical expertise for installation, hosting, and maintenance.
User interface may appear less modern than some commercial alternatives.
Support is primarily community-based, which may vary in responsiveness.
Features like LDAP or SAML might require additional configuration or development depending on the specific version or community contributions.
